Chapter 663 Build Cemeteries

Being stared at by the crowd, Ewan blushed as he lowered his head in embarrassment.

“You guys died because you tried to protect the country. However, you should not kill them just because they dug up your corpses. Those are a lot of lives that we are talking about here…” Jared uttered.

“Those people are not dead. They are just trapped inside the forest, around five hundred meters to the west.”

The ghost pointed toward the west.

After hearing those people were still alive, Ludovic immediately headed to the west to search for them. Sure enough, he brought back a dozen of men. However, all those people looked disheveled after getting trapped for a few days.

Upon seeing that, Ewan regretted his actions deeply. I should not have been so obsessed with wealth. I nearly killed these people.

Jared realized the ghost did not harm anyone and was previously a warrior during his lifetime. Thus, Jared’s hostility faded instantly.

“This decamillennium ginseng won’t be able to make you guys into human form. Since you had sacrificed your lives for the country, we should build tombstones to let your souls be in peace…”

Upon saying that, Jared glanced at Ewan. “Mr. Sabine, all this happened because of your greed. Are you willing to donate some money to build a cemetery for these fallen warriors? We should also burn some sacrifices for them.”

 

“Sure. I am willing to do so…”

Ewan kept nodding his head as he fell to his knees. “I am willing to provide the money and build a cemetery at the foot of the mountain. We should let our future generations remember these warriors forever…”

 

Ewan bawled his eyes out. It seemed like he had truly repented. Those of the Sabine family also knelt one after another. It was indeed a massive sin that their family had committed.

All the other family members bowed toward Jared as well. Even though Jared was still young, they had witnessed his ability with their own eyes.

“Mr. Sabine, you have to compensate for what you have done. Please keep your promise…” Jared told Ewan.

Ewan’s face became red again. “Of course. I won’t back out on my words. I will arrange for my men to start right away and collect all these remains.”

“Mr. Sabine, since the matter is resolved, let’s talk about the price for the decamillennium ginseng. After all, you were the one who found it.”

Only then did Jared touch on his real purpose for coming here.

Ewan immediately waved his hand upon hearing that. “Mr. Chance, take it if you need it. I have been obsessed with wealth all my life. Today I finally understand that money is not the most important thing in life. The wealth of the Sabine family would not diminish even after a few generations. In the future, I will continue to fund the construction of cemeteries all over the country. I will also find the families of those warriors and help them.”
